Grammar usage guide and real-world examples

USAGE SUMMARY

The phrase "we were influenced" is correct and usable in written English.
You can use it when discussing how someone or something has had an effect on your thoughts, actions, or decisions. Example: "In our research, we found that we were influenced by various cultural factors that shaped our perspectives."

Expert writing Tips

Best practice

When using "we were influenced", be specific about what influenced you and the nature of that influence. Provide context to enhance clarity.

Common error

Avoid using "we were influenced" too often without specifying the influencing factor. Over-reliance on the passive voice can make your writing vague and less engaging. Instead of saying "We were influenced," consider "X influenced us," which is more direct.

FAQs

How can I use "we were influenced" in a sentence?

You can use "we were influenced" to describe how external factors affected your decisions, ideas, or creations. For instance, "In developing this product, "we were influenced" by customer feedback and market trends."

What are some alternatives to "we were influenced"?

Depending on the context, you can use alternatives like "we were affected", "we were inspired by", or "we took cues from".

Is it better to use active or passive voice with "we were influenced"?

While "we were influenced" (passive voice) is grammatically correct, using the active voice can often make your writing more direct and engaging. For example, instead of ""we were influenced" by the Beatles", you could say "The Beatles influenced us".

How does "we were influenced" differ from "we were inspired"?

"We were influenced" suggests a broader range of effects, while "we were inspired" specifically indicates that something motivated or encouraged you creatively. Influence can be positive, negative, or neutral, while inspiration is generally positive.
